Daniel Kastner's video: Boost your songwriting with microKORG timbres - Purity Ring Begin Again song patch

@Boost your songwriting with microKORG timbres - Purity Ring "Begin Again" song patch
Headphones recommended for the bass sounds. In this video tutorial, I will show you how to utilize bass and lead sounds in a single patch with the Korg microKORG by using layered timbres. These textures and bass sounds can be combined for recording and live composition. These sounds can also be soloed for one-of-a-kind performances. "Begin Again" by Purity Ring https://youtu.be/ftkJNilA4Ao Introduction 0:42 Bass sound 1:12 Lead sound 1:43 Bass and Lead sound (bugain!) 2:00 Timbre use 2:10 Setting up the Bass sound: 2:33 Setting up the Lead sound 5:34 Limitations 8:00 Filter cutoff on Bass (super cool) 8:38 Filter cutoff on Lead (super cool) 9:11 Bass release tweaks (headphones rec'd) 10:10 Bass line is close to B D D # F F # Lead line is close to B B F # F # D D C # C # D / B B F # F # D D C # C # E For questions, please comment below.
